How Apple Pay Works in Online Casinos

Apple Pay works by linking a debit or credit card to the Apple Wallet app. When a player makes a deposit at an online casino, the payment is confirmed with Face ID, Touch ID, or a device passcode.

The casino never receives the player’s actual card number. Instead, Apple Pay sends a secure token to complete the transaction. This adds an extra layer of protection compared to entering card details directly.

Deposits are usually instant, so players can start playing without delay. Withdrawals, however, depend on the casino’s processing times. Some casinos support Apple Pay withdrawals, while others only allow deposits.

Players can use Apple Pay on iPhones, iPads, and Macs. Many Canadian casinos also optimise their sites for mobile users, making the process smooth across different devices.

Setting Up Apple Pay for Gambling

To start, the player needs an Apple device such as an iPhone, iPad, or Mac. Apple Pay must be linked to a valid debit or credit card issued by a Canadian bank. Most major banks support Apple Pay, but it is best to confirm with the card provider.

The setup is done through the Wallet app. After opening the app, the player taps the “+” symbol to add a card. The device will guide them to scan the card or enter details manually.

Once the card is verified by the bank, Apple Pay becomes active. For added security, the player should enable Face ID, Touch ID, or a passcode. This ensures that every casino payment requires confirmation before it is processed.

Apple Pay vs. Credit Cards

Credit cards like Visa and Mastercard remain common at Canadian casinos, but they often come with slower withdrawal times. Processing can take several business days, while Apple Pay deposits usually appear instantly.

Security also differs. Apple Pay uses tokenisation and biometric ID, while credit cards rely on card numbers that can be exposed during transactions. This makes Apple Pay less likely to face fraud or chargeback issues.

Fees are another factor. Some casinos or banks may add charges for credit card deposits, while Apple Pay transactions usually avoid extra costs. Players who prefer quick, low‑friction payments often find Apple Pay more convenient than using a card directly.

Apple Pay vs. Interac

Interac e‑Transfer is one of the most popular payment methods in Canada. It allows players to move money directly from their bank account to the casino. Many trust Interac because it is widely accepted and backed by Canadian banks.

The main difference is speed. Interac deposits are fast but may not always be instant, while Apple Pay transactions typically process immediately. Withdrawals with Interac can also take longer depending on the bank.

Apple Pay stands out for mobile use. Players can confirm payments with Face ID or Touch ID in seconds. Interac, on the other hand, often requires logging into online banking and entering security questions. Both are secure, but Apple Pay is often simpler for those who gamble on mobile devices.

Apple Pay vs. E‑Wallets

E‑wallets like P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ller are known for fast deposits and withdrawals. They act as a middle layer between the bank and the casino, which adds privacy but also requires a separate account.

Apple Pay works directly with a user’s bank card stored on their iPhone or iPad. This removes the need for setting up and funding an extra wallet. Deposits are just as quick, and authentication is built into the device.

However, e‑wallets sometimes support withdrawals at more casinos than Apple Pay. In many cases, Apple Pay is limited to deposits only, while PayPal or Skrill can handle both directions. Players who want a single method for deposits and withdrawals may prefer an e‑wallet, but those who value simplicity often choose Apple Pay.

Encryption and Authentication

Apple Pay uses tokenisation, which replaces a card number with a unique code for each transaction. Casinos never see the actual card number, lowering the risk of theft.

Each payment also requires Face ID, Touch ID, or a passcode. This step ensures that only the device owner can approve deposits or withdrawals.

Apple Pay works with the Secure Element chip built into Apple devices. This hardware-based security adds another layer of protection against hackers.

Together, these measures make it harder for criminals to intercept or misuse payment details. Players can deposit funds without typing in sensitive card numbers on casino websites.

Troubleshooting Payment Problems

Apple Pay transactions may not always process smoothly at online casinos. A failed deposit often happens if the player’s bank does not authorise gambling payments. Some banks block these transactions by default for security or policy reasons.

Another common issue is using an unsupported card. Apple Pay works only with cards from participating banks, so if the linked card is not eligible, the payment will fail. Players should also confirm that their device has a stable internet connection, as weak signals can interrupt the transaction.

To fix most issues, players should:

    • Check card eligibility with their bank.

    • Update device software to the latest iOS or macOS version.

    • Verify account balance before making a deposit.

    • Try another payment method if Apple Pay continues to fail.

These steps usually resolve the most frequent payment errors without the need for further assistance.
